Corrections Policy

Corrections Policy

Stingray System values accuracy in all content we publish. We commit to providing our readers with factual and reliable information. Errors can occur, and we take swift, transparent action to correct them. Our goal is to maintain trust and transparency with our audience.

Types of Corrections

We categorize errors into three types based on their impact and nature:

  • Minor Corrections: These include typos, grammatical errors, broken links, or minor factual inaccuracies that do not alter the overall meaning of an article. We fix these quickly without a formal note.
  • Significant Corrections: These are substantive factual errors, misrepresentations, or omissions that could mislead readers or change the understanding of the content. Such corrections receive a clear notice.
  • Retractions: We issue a retraction when an article contains fundamental errors or inaccuracies that invalidate its entire premise. This action is rare and indicates the content no longer meets our editorial standards.

How Corrections Are Noted

For significant corrections, we add a clear editor’s note. This note appears at the top or bottom of the affected article. It states what was corrected, the date of the correction, and the reason for the change. Retracted articles will display a prominent notice indicating their retraction status.
